Abstract
Embodiment of the present invention is related to shower field, disclose the control method and intelligent shower head of a kind of intelligent shower head, whether the method includes determine human body in the spray field of intelligent shower head, when human body is in the spray field of intelligent shower head, obtain the deviation angle of human body and intelligent shower head, determine angular range at deviation angle, water yield grade is determined according to identified angular range, wherein, water yield grade and angular range have corresponding relationship, according to water yield grade, the water yield of intelligent shower head is controlled.Through the above way, embodiment of the present invention is able to achieve the size that intelligent shower head automatically adjusts water spray water according to position of human body, reduce the water waste during people have a bath, while also reducing the operation of manual switching water during people have a bath, offers convenience for people.

Specific embodiment
The present invention is described in detail with embodiment with reference to the accompanying drawing.
Embodiment one
Referring to Fig. 1, embodiment of the present invention provides a kind of control method of intelligent shower head, comprising:
Step 101: determining human body whether in the spray field of intelligent shower head;
Determine whether human body is in the covered range of intelligent shower head water spray when institute first.
Step 102: when human body is in the spray field of intelligent shower head, obtaining the deviation angle of human body and intelligent shower head
Degree;
Deviation angle be intelligent shower head and ground vertical line section between the two and intelligent shower head and human body head between the two
Line segment angle.Deviation angle can be constantly changing with the movement of human body, when human body is closer to intelligent shower head and ground two
When vertical line section between person, deviation angle is smaller, on the contrary then deviation angle is bigger, when human body is in the shower ontology of intelligent shower head
Underface when, namely intelligent shower head and the vertical line section of ground between the two and intelligent shower head and human body head be between the two at this time
Line segment be overlapped, at this time deviation angle be zero degree.Deviation angle can reflect out the positional relationship of intelligent shower head and human body.
Optionally, step 101 can also be executed by first obtaining the deviation angle of human body and intelligent shower head, i.e., first obtained
The deviation angle of human body and intelligent shower head, when the deviation angle is in the covered angular range of intelligent shower head water spray when institute
When, it is determined that human body is in the spray field of intelligent shower head, and on the contrary then determining human body is not located at the spray field of intelligent shower head
It is interior, it should be noted that: deviation angle is intelligent shower head and ground vertical line section between the two and intelligent shower head and human body head
The angle of line segment between the two, therefore, it is necessary to which meeting human body head comes into the covered model of intelligent shower head water spray when institute
In enclosing, it just can determine that human body is in the spray field of intelligent shower head, ensure that when the whole body of human body is all completely in intelligence
When in the spray field of energy shower, just calculates confirmation human body and be in the spray field of intelligent shower head.
Step 103: determining angular range at deviation angle;
The angular range covered range when spraying water for intelligent shower head, and according to the water spray angle of intelligent shower head by small
It is divided into several angular ranges to the covered range of senior general's intelligent shower head water spray when institute.
Step 104: water yield grade being determined according to identified angular range, wherein water yield grade and angular range
With corresponding relationship;
All angles range corresponds to a water yield grade, and a water yield grade represents a kind of size of water yield.
Step 105: according to water yield grade, controlling the water yield of intelligent shower head.
The size of the water yield of intelligent shower head is controlled according to identified water yield grade.

Height H of the intelligent shower head apart from ground has been determined after intelligent shower head installation and has been stored in intelligent shower head
It is interior, human height h can by people by the APP on the mobile terminals such as mobile phone be uploaded to intelligent shower head or by intelligent shower head it is direct
Detection obtains.
Fig. 3 and Fig. 4 are please referred to, in embodiments of the present invention, angular range is covered model when intelligent shower head is sprayed water
It encloses, optionally, angular range includes small deviation range J, middle deviation range K and big deviation range L, and small deviation range J is close
The range of intelligent shower head and the vertical line section of ground between the two, big deviation range L are hanging down between the two far from intelligent shower head and ground
The range of line segment, range of the middle deviation range K between small deviation range J and big deviation range L.Specifically, with intelligent shower head
Line segment AB perpendicular to the ground is a right-angle side of a right angled triangle ABD, wherein intelligent shower head is located at A point, with a small offset
Field angle a is the angle of the other side of the right-angle side, which is angle of coverage when intelligent shower head is sprayed water
A part, the line segment AD that the another a line of the small deviation range angle a connect after extending with ground is right angled triangle ABD
Bevel edge, so that it is determined that right angled triangle ABD, right angled triangle ABD are using right-angle side AB as axis, rotate by a certain angle M, works as AD
When turning to AD1, BD and turning to BD1, which is obtained by the range rotated, optionally, angle M can for 180 ° or
360 ° etc., when acquired deviation angle is less than or equal to small deviation range angle a, that is, it is small partially to determine that deviation angle is in this
It moves in range J;Similarly, a right-angle side for being a right angled triangle ABE with the line segment AB of intelligent shower head perpendicular to the ground, in one
Deviation range angle b is the angle of the other side of the right-angle side, and deviation range angle b is covering when intelligent shower head is sprayed water in this
A part of angle, the line segment AE that another a line of deviation range angle b is connect after extending with ground in this are the right angle trigonometry
The bevel edge of shape ABE, so that it is determined that right angled triangle ABE, right angled triangle ABE rotates by a certain angle using right-angle side AB as axis
M, when AE, which turns to AE1, BE, turns to BE1, the range of rotation obtains deviation range K in this after subtracting small deviation range J, can
Choosing, angle M can be 180 ° or 360 ° etc., when the deviation angle being calculated be less than or equal to middle deviation range angle b and
When greater than small deviation range angle a, that is, determine that deviation angle is in this in deviation range K;Similarly, vertically with intelligent shower head
The line segment AB in face is a right-angle side of a right angled triangle ABE, take a big deviation range angle c as the other side of the right-angle side
Angle, which is covered maximum magnitude angle when intelligent shower head is sprayed water, the big deviation range angle
The line segment AC that the another a line of c is connect after extending with ground is the bevel edge of right angled triangle ABC, so that it is determined that right angled triangle
ABC, right angled triangle ABC are using right-angle side AB as axis, and rotate by a certain angle M, when AC, which turns to AC1, BC, turns to BC1,
The range of rotation obtains the big deviation range L after subtracting small deviation range J and middle deviation range K, and optionally, angle M can be
180 ° or 360 ° etc., when the deviation angle being calculated is less than or equal to big deviation range angle c and is greater than middle deviation range
When angle b, that is, determine that deviation angle is in the big deviation range.
Further, in order to which each angular range is better described and makes the uniform in size of each angular range, with intelligent shower head
Vertical line section AB between ground is one side, it is assumed that the maximum magnitude angle when intelligent shower head is sprayed water is equal to big deviation range angle
C is spent, small deviation range angle a is enabled to be equal to the one third of big deviation range angle c, middle deviation range angle b is equal to big offset
2/3rds of field angle c, thus maximum magnitude angle trisection when intelligent shower head is sprayed water, be less than when deviation angle or
When equal to c/3, deviation angle is in small deviation range J;When deviation angle is greater than c/3 and is less than or equal to 2c/3, deviation angle
Degree is in middle deviation range K;When deviation angle is greater than 2c/3 and is less than or equal to c, deviation angle is in big deviation range L;
Water yield grade corresponds to the size of water yield, and water yield grade includes high water yield, middle water yield and low water yield.
Small deviation range J corresponds to high water yield, water yield in middle deviation range K correspondence, and big deviation range L corresponds to low water yield.To
Realize when human body is closer to intelligent shower head, determining water yield higher grade, and the water yield of shower is bigger, when human body further away from
When intelligent shower head, determining water yield lower grade, and the water yield of shower is smaller, therefore, when people want during bathing
When smear soap, give a rubdown with a damp towel etc. the small movement of water requirements, it is only necessary to which reduction can be realized far from intelligent shower head in itself mobile human body
The purpose of water, when people want rush the big movement of the water requirements such as bath, it is only necessary to which itself mobile human body is close to intelligence flower
It spills, the purpose for increasing water can be realized.
In embodiments of the present invention, people by the APP selection of the mobile terminals such as mobile phone or setting water yield grade and
The specific value of each deviation range.
In embodiments of the present invention, due to people, continually movement causes water suddenly big during bathing in order to prevent
Suddenly small, therefore water yield grade is determined according to identified angular range in above-mentioned steps 204, wherein the water yield grade
With angular range have corresponding relationship, further includes: when intelligent shower head be in water spray state, and identified angular range and
When the angular range of a upper determination is not identical, the deviation angle for detecting human body and intelligent shower head is in identified angular range
Duration;When duration is greater than or equal to default delay duration, water yield etc. is determined according to identified angular range
Grade.Optionally, the default delay duration can be arranged by the APP of the mobile terminals such as mobile phone and be uploaded to intelligent shower head by people,
Default delay duration is 3 seconds or 5 seconds etc..Therefore as people during bathing itself mobile position of human body and the change deviation angle
When angular range locating for degree, identified water yield grade can't immediately change, but change deviation angle in people
After locating angular range reaches certain duration, identified water yield grade can just change, to prevent from existing due to people
Continually movement causes water suddenly big or suddenly small during having a bath.
Step 206: when determining that human body leaves the spray field of intelligent shower head, detection human body leaves the water spray model of intelligent shower head
That encloses leaves duration, and when length is greater than or equal to preset stopping duration when exiting, control intelligent shower head stops water spray movement.
In embodiments of the present invention, after human body leaves the spray field of intelligent shower head for a long time in order to prevent, intelligence
Shower is still being sprayed water, and the waste of water, therefore the control method of the intelligent shower head are caused further include: when intelligent shower head is in spray
When water state, and human body is determined when leaving the spray field of intelligent shower head, detection human body leaves the spray field of intelligent shower head
Leave duration, long when being greater than or equal to preset stopping duration when exiting, control intelligent shower head stops water spray movement.It is optional
, the preset stopping duration can be arranged by the APP of the mobile terminals such as mobile phone and be uploaded to intelligent shower head by people, preset stopping
Shi Changwei 5 seconds or 10 seconds etc..Therefore, after people leave the spray field of intelligent shower head for a long time, intelligent shower head is in detection
When time reaches preset stopping duration, just controls intelligent shower head and stop water spray movement, prevent the waste of water, meanwhile, in people
Short time leave the spray field of intelligent shower head after, intelligent shower head will not immediately stop water spray movement, prevent people of short duration
The movement for also needing that intelligent shower head is made to restart water spray back after leaving.Certainly, people can also be by directly closing intelligence
The power supply of shower directly controls intelligent shower head stopping water spray by the APP of the terminal devices such as mobile phone.

Embodiment three
Referring to Fig. 5, embodiment of the present invention provides a kind of intelligent shower head (figure is not infused), comprising: (figure is not for shower ontology
Show), processor 301, memory 302, water flow controller 303, first sensor 304 and second sensor 305;
Processor 301 and water flow controller 303, memory 302, first sensor 304 and second sensor 305 pass through total
Line connection;Memory 302 is for storing the operational order executed by processor 301, when operational order is performed, processor
301 execute:
The sensed data that first sensor 304 is sent is received, determines human body whether in intelligent shower head according to sensed data
In spray field, optionally, first sensor 304 is infrared inductor, and after starting intelligent shower head switch, infrared inductor is to intelligence
Infra-red detection signal, the spray field for whether being in intelligent shower head for detecting human body can be emitted in the spray field of shower
It is interior, if the infra-red detection signal of infrared inductor transmitting blocks in spread scope without human body, infra-red detection signal
Strength retrogression it is smaller, thus sensed data determines that human body is not in the spray field of intelligent shower head, if infrared inductor send out
The infra-red detection signal penetrated has human body to block in spread scope, then the strength retrogression of its infra-red detection signal is larger, by
This sensed data determines that human body is being in the spray field of intelligent shower head.
When human body is in the spray field of intelligent shower head, the detection data that second sensor 305 is sent is received, according to
Detection data obtains the deviation angle of human body and shower ontology, and optionally, second sensor 305 is position sensor, for surveying
Relative position and the distance of human body and intelligent shower head are measured, and the detection data that measurement obtains is sent to processor 301.
Determine angular range at deviation angle;
Water yield grade is determined according to identified angular range, wherein water yield grade has corresponding with angular range
Relationship;
According to water yield grade, water flow controller 303 is controlled to control the water yield of intelligent shower head.
